CLARK, N.J. (AP) — At least one "Christmas Vacation" fan was driving on New Jersey's Garden State Parkway Thursday.

Someone changed a sign for the highway's exit for Clark and Westfield to read "Clark Griswold."

Griswold is the father's character played by Chevy Chase in the Christmas cult classic.

State Police spokesman Sgt. Gregory Williams confirms photos of the sign posted on social media are real.

Williams says the taped-on Griswold sign at the highway's exit 135 later was removed by the Turnpike Authority.
